body {
	font-size:62.5%;
 	margin-left: 1.5em;
	margin-top: 1.5em;
	margin-bottom: 1.5em;
}

img { border: 0; }

.oculta { 
visibility: hidden; 
}

/*+++++++++++
  CABECERA
++++++++++++*/

#cabecera{
	min-width:96.9em;
	margin-right:-0.5em;
	padding-right:1.5em;
}

#cab_logo{
	margin-top:-4em;
}

#marco_cab{
	background: #e3e5d7;
	height:12.3em;
	margin-top:-18.5em;
	margin-bottom:0.6em;
	margin-left:19.5em;
 	background-image: url(../img/jardin/cab_2a.jpg);
 	background-position:right;
 	background-repeat:no-repeat;
}

#cuadro_sup{
	position:relative;
	height:1.8em;
	border:0.01em solid #000000;
}

#cuadro_inf{
	position:relative;
	margin-top:8.7em;
	height:1.65em;
	border:0.01em solid #a4a4a4;
}

#buzon{
	position:relative;
	float:right;
	background:#656801;
	border-left:0.01em solid #000000;
	height:1.7em;
    top:0.1em;
}

.buzon_ciud{
    position:relative;
	font-size:1.1em;
    color:#FFFFFF;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
    left:0.1em;
    top:0.08em;  
}

.letras_migas{
    font-size:1.1em;
    color:#000000;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
	padding-left:1em;
}

.a_migas{
    font-size:1.1em;
    color:#000000;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
}
.migas{
       position:relative;
       top:0.1em;
       left:0.5em;
}

#salt_cont{
	position:relative;
	float:left;
	background:#dcdede;
	border-right:0.01em solid #000000;
	height:1.6em;
	left:0.1em;
	top:0.1em;
}

.letras_salt_cont{
    position:relative;
    font-size:1.1em;
    color:#000000;
    text-decoration:none;
    font-family:Arial, Helvetica, sans-serif;
    top:0.1em;  
}

#buscador{
	position:relative;
	float:right;
	height:1.7em;
  	top:-1.4em;

}

#cse-search-results iframe {
        width: 100%;
}

.text_input{ 
	position:absolute; 
    right:4.9em;
    font-family: Arial, Helvetica, sans-serif;
    border: 0.01em solid #a4a4a4;
	height:1.3em;
	font-size:1.1em;
    padding-left:0.5em;
}

.bot_buscar{
	border:0em;
	font-family:Arial, Helvetica, sans-serif;
	font-size:1.1em;
	height:1.5em;
	background:#656801;
	color:#FFFFFF;
	padding-bottom:0.1em;
}

/*+++++++++++
    MENU
++++++++++++*/

#menu_izq{
 	position:relative;
 	float:left;
 	margin-left:0.2em;
 	margin-top:-4.4em;
 	width:18.2em;
	margin-bottom:22.5em;
}

.li_menu{
	list-style-type:none;
	background-image: url(../img/jardin/boton.jpg);
	border-bottom: 0.1em solid #FFFFFF;
	margin-left:-4em;
}

.menu_enl{
    font-size:1.2em;
    color:#000000;
	text-decoration:none;
	font-family:Arial, Helvetica, sans-serif;
}

li a{
	text-decoration:none;
	font-size:1.2em;
	color:#000000;
	font-family:Arial, Helvetica, sans-serif;
}

.submenus{
	padding-left:1em;
}

/*+++++++++++
    CUERPO
++++++++++++*/
#contenidos{
	margin-left:19.6em;
	margin-top:-3em;
	padding-right:1em;
}

#contenedor{
	margin-top:-1.5em;
	margin-bottom:0em;
	width:100%;
	min-width:98em;
	margin-right:1em;
}
/*+++++++++++
    PIE
++++++++++++*/

#pie{
	background:#011576;
	clear:both;
	text-align:center;
	min-width:96.9em;
	margin-right:1em;
	margin-top:2em;
}

.letras_pie{
	font-size:1.1em;
	color:#ffffff;
	font-family:Arial, Helvetica, sans-serif;
}

.enl_pie{
	text-decoration:none;
	font-size:1.1em;
	color:#ffffff;
	font-family:Arial, Helvetica, sans-serif;
}

/*+++++++++++
    OTROS
++++++++++++*/

a{
text-decoration: none;
}

a:hover{
text-decoration: underline;
}

.negrita_color{
	color:#656300;
	font-weight:bold;
}

.negrita{
	font-weight:bold;
}

.cursiva{
	font-style:oblique;
}
p{
	font-family:Arial, Helvetica, sans-serif;
	font-size:1.2em;
	text-align:justify;
}

h2{
	color:#636500;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:2em;
	text-align:justify;
}

.titul_ayuda{
	color:#636500;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:2em;
	text-align:justify;
}

h3{
	color:#636500;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:1.7em;
	text-align:center;
}

hr{
	padding: 0;
	border: solid #636500;
	border-width: 0.01em 0 0 0;
	color: #636500;
	height: 0.01em;
 	margin-top:-1em;
   	margin-bottom:1.5em;
}

.letras_ocultas{
	margin:0em;
	padding:0em;
	font-size:0em;
	
}

.hueco{
	display: none;      
}

.no_hueco{
	display: block;
}
/*Imagen de la p�gina de Inicio*/
.img_principal{
	margin-top:-0.2em;
	margin-bottom:-1.5em;
}

/*Imagen de la p�gina de Gu�a del Jard�n*/
.imagen_guia{
	text-align:center;
}

/*Propiedades relativas a la p�gina contenido.jc*/
#conttexto {
	width: 71%;
	float: left;
	padding-right: 1.5em;
	margin-top:-1.5em;
}

#contgraf {
	text-align: center;
	width: 26.5%;
	float: right;
}

#contgraf img{
	margin-bottom:2em;
}


/*Propiedades relativas a la secci�n de Gu�a del Jard�n*/
.li_guia{
	list-style-type:none;
	display:inline; 
}

.cuadro_li{
	float:left;
	width:30%;
	margin-bottom:0.5em;
	background-image: url(../img/jardin/punto.jpg);
	background-position:left;
 	background-repeat:no-repeat;
}

.enlace_guia{
	padding-left:1em;
	color:#0000cc;
	font-size:1.3em;
}


/*Propiedades relativas a la secci�n de Enlaces*/

.titul_enl{
	color:#000000;
	font-family:Arial, Helvetica, sans-serif;/*modf fuente*/
	padding-left:1em;
	font-size:1.5em;
	font-weight:bold;
	text-align:left;
}

.li_enlaces{
	list-style-type:circle;
    margin-bottom:1.5em; 
}

.letras_enlaces{
	color:#0000cc;
    font-size:1.3em;
    font-family:Arial, Helvetica, sans-serif; /*modf fuente*/
}

/*Propiedades relativas a la secci�n de Endemismos en peligro y Bot�nica Macaron�sica*/
.li_endemismo_macaronesica{
	color:#003300;
	list-style-type:circle;
    margin-bottom:1.5em; 
}

.letras_endemismo_macaronesica{
    color:#0000cc;
    font-size:1.3em;
    font-family: Arial, Helvetica, sans-serif;/*modf fuente*/ 
}

.tamano{    color:#000000;
    font-size:1.3em;
    font-family:Arial, Helvetica, sans-serif;/*modf fuente*/ 
}



#rest_cont{
/*	margin-bottom:24em;*/
}

/*Propiedades relativas a la secci�n de Revista de Bot�nica Macaron�sica */
.ul_revista{
	width:81%;
	float:left;
	padding-top:0em;
	padding-left:0.5em;
	margin-top:0em;
    margin-left:3em; 
}

.cuadro_paginas{
	float:left;
	width:11%;
	margin-left:2.5em;
}

/*Propiedades relativas a la secci�n de Contacto*/

#imagen_contacto{
	float:left;
	margin-top:2.5em;
	margin-left:2.5em;
	margin-bottom:8.5em;
}

#contacto_texto{
	float:left;
	margin-top:1.6em;
	width:53%;
}

#contacto_texto p{
	margin-bottom:2.2em;
}

/*Propiedades relativas a la barra horizontal de la secci�n de Flora de Gran Canaria*/

#barra_enl_flora{
 	background:#e3e5d7;
	margin-bottom:2.5em;
	text-align:center;
	padding-left:2em;
}

.li_flora{
	list-style-type:none;
	display:inline;
}

.submenus_flora{
	color:#636500;
	font-weight:bold;
	font-size:1.5em;
	padding-right:4em;
}

.titulo_flora{
	color:#626500;
	font-family:Arial, Helvetica, sans-serif;/*modf fuente*/
	font-size:1.3em;
	margin-left:0.5em;
}

/*Propiedades relativas al enlace de ayuda en la secci�n de Flora*/

#cont_ayuda{
	min-width:98em;
}

#conttexto_ayuda{
	float:left;
	width:76%;
}

.cuadro_enlace{
	clear:both;
	float:right;
	margin-bottom:2em;
	margin-right:2em;
}

.enlace_ayuda{
	font-family:Arial;
	font-size:1.3em;
	color:#0000cc;
}

/*Propiedades relativas a la secci�n de Espacios Naturales*/

.cuadro_espacio{
	width:13.6%;
	float:left;
	text-align:center;
	margin-right:0.5em;
}

.cuadro_espacio p{
	text-align:center;
	margin:0em;
}
.enlaces_espacio{
	text-decoration:none;
	color:#000000;
	font-family:Arial, Helvetica, sans-serif;/*modf fuente*/
	font-weight:bold;
	font-size:1.1em;
}

#barra_enl_espacios{
 	margin-bottom:12em;
}

#conttexto_espacio {
	width: 64%;
	float: left;
    margin-left:1.5em;
	margin-top:-1.5em;
    text-align: center;
}

#contgraf_enl_espacios {
	width: 33.5%;
	float: left;
	border-right:0.01em solid #636500; 
	margin-bottom:3em;
}

.titulo_espacios{
	font-weight:bold;
	font-size:1em;
	font-family:Arial, Helvetica, sans-serif;/*modf fuente*/
	text-align:left;
}

.ul_espacios{
	margin-bottom:2.5em;
}

.li_espacios{ 
    color:#00555a;	
	list-style-type:circle;
	margin-bottom:0.5em;

}

.enlace_espacios{
	color:#0000cc;
	font-family:Arial, Helvetica, sans-serif;
	font-size:1.3em;/*modf fuente*/ 
}

#img_princ_espacios{
	margin-left:-2em;
}

#img_espacios{
	margin-top:2em;
}

/*Propiedades relativas a la secci�n de Organigrama*/

#organigrama1{
	text-align:center;
}

#cuadro_enl_organigrama{
	margin-top:2em;
	/*margin-bottom:-3em;*/
}

.enlace_organigrama{
	color:#0000cc;
	font-family:Arial, Helvetica, sans-serif;/*modf fuente*/
	font-size:1.3em;
}

.sub_titulo{
	text-align:left;
}

.cuadro_revista{
	float:left;
	width:22%;
	padding:1em;
	text-align:center;
}
.cuadro_revista p{
	text-align:center;
}
div.centro-izq{font-size:1.2em;width:51em;float:left;}
div.centro-der {font-size:1.2em;float:right;width:12em;}
div.centro-der img {width:12em; border:1px solid #636500; margin-bottom:0.5em;}
.negrita{color:black;}
div.form_busc_flora{font-size:1.2em}
div.listadoespecies{font-size:1.2em}
table.listadoespecies{font-family:Arial, Helvetica, sans-serif;}
.titulo-especie{font-size:1.5em;color:#636500;}
.verde{color:#636500;}
table.listadolocalizaciones{font-family:Arial, Helvetica, sans-serif;}
.fondoverde{background:#E9E9C4}
div.localizaciones {font-size:1.2em;width:30em;float:left;}
#mapaisla {font-size:1.2em;float:right;width:400px;height:400px;background-color:green;}
div.contenedortabla{overflow-x:auto;overflow-y:auto;height:27em;}
